Output 07344089100efcd6cb264f6e003af3aba27f9b1ec9aa882c263eabf365df3822:0

value
468135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74468c0d77b03313a312b490615394073f96fe22 OP_EQUAL
address
3CHppVZGf6aTgscXWrxziq8n2dt8b3HZ8q
transaction
07344089100efcd6cb264f6e003af3aba27f9b1ec9aa882c263eabf365df3822
spent
true